#12e89d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12e89d is composed of 7.1% red, 91%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 49%. #12e89d color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#00d13b.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

Shades and Tints of #12e89d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e09 is the darkest color, while #fafff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#12e89d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7e7d is the less saturated color, while #08f2a0 is the most saturated one.
